SUMMARY AND BACKGROUND:
The City’s implementation of Priority Based Budgeting, one of the actions from City Council’s Policy Agenda for 2018, includes comprehensive and inclusive definitions for the six results areas from the City Strategic Plan. The result areas are Good Governance; Natural Environment Stewardship; Safe Community; Safe, Reliable, and Efficient Infrastructure; Strong and Diverse Economy; and Welcoming and Livable Community.
FACTS AND FINDINGS:
On Thursday, June 28, 2018, the Sustainable Services Work Group - Councilors Andersen, Ausec, Cook, and McCoid - was joined by Mayor Bennett to collaborate on five definitions for each of the six result areas. The definitions need to be generous in scope; inclusive of the Council’s vision, mission, and values; inform the strategic plan and policy agenda; and broad enough to encompass the City’s diverse services.
The completed results will be used in the Priority Based Budgeting scoring process to determine a program’s influence (a range of “essential” to “no influence at all”) on the community-focused outcomes in the six result areas.
The result of the Sustainable Services Work Group’s collaboration is attached, City of Salem Result Areas. Also attached is a basic timeline of the City’s activities related to the Priority Based Budgeting implementation.
